The average cost of living in Kuala Terengganu is $465, which is in the top 6% of the least expensive cities in the world, ranked 8707th out of 9294 in our global list and 30th out of 34 in Malaysia.

The median after-tax salary is $424, which is enough to cover living expenses for 0.9 months. Ranked 6808th (TOP 73%) in the list of best places to live in the world and 30th best city to live in Malaysia. With an estimated population of 255K, Kuala Terengganu is the 19th largest city in Malaysia.
